Actor Fatima Sana Shaikh was recently seen stepping out of a popular celebrity hair studio in Bandra, turning heads with her elegant and minimal fashion choice. Known for her effortless style, the Dangal actor opted for a soft, dusty pink traditional outfit that perfectly balanced comfort with sophistication.

Fatima wore a beautifully designed kurta set from the label Aikeyah. The outfit featured a relaxed A-line kurta in a dusty rose shade called “Onion.” The kurta had a soft V-neckline that subtly highlighted her collarbones, along with a layered and flowy silhouette that added volume and grace to the overall look. Made from lightweight chanderi fabric, the outfit appeared breathable and ideal for summer wear.

The kurta was paired with matching ghagra-style dhoti pants, designed with a similar layered pattern that enhanced the outfit’s fluid and airy feel. Completing the monochrome look, she draped a sheer organza dupatta in a blush tone, detailed with delicate embellishments and scalloped edges.

Her accessories added a traditional yet bold touch. Fatima chose oversized oxidised silver jhumkas and a simple pendant necklace, maintaining a balance between statement and subtle styling. She completed her look with blush-toned heels from Steve Madden, which complemented the outfit perfectly.

Her beauty look was kept soft and natural, featuring dewy skin, neutral lips, and lightly defined eyes. She styled her hair in loose, voluminous waves, adding to the effortless glamour.

The kurta set is priced at ₹56,500, while the heels cost ₹5,999, making the look a blend of luxury and everyday elegance.

Fatima Sana Shaikh’s latest appearance showcases how simple, well-coordinated outfits can create a strong fashion statement. Her dusty pink ensemble is a perfect inspiration for those looking for stylish yet comfortable ethnic wear, especially during the summer season.
